Devices used:
- RB2011UiAS-2HnD-IN, RouterOS to v6.29.1.
- Toshiba Satellite U500-1F4 with Atheros AR9285 wireless adapter.
- Other Wi-Fi devices, such as Galaxy SII phone and Toshiba Satellite A300-20Q (all N-capable).
There is one wireless network configured with hidden SSID.
Wireless connection in Windows 7 has been created manually with WPA2-AES-PSK and options to connect automatically even if the network isn't broadcasting SSID.
If the network is "2GHz-only-N" U500-1F4 does not connect. All other Wi-Fi devices connect flawlessly.
If SSID hiding is off or if network type is "2GHz-B/G/N" or "2GHz-only-G" U500-1F4 connects automatically.
How to determine on which side is the bug and how to eliminate it?
